The Hamburg business magazine ‘Brand eins’ (Brand one) carried the lead title ‘Don’t panic! This is not the end once again’. And the ‘Brand eins’ editorial team are most correct in their assumption. It is high time to free our minds from the hysteria on the international financial markets, high time to view the future realistically!
Needless to say, the coming months will not necessarily be an easy ride for the MICE business. The Deutsche Bank’s own chief economist echoed similar sentiments to the ‘Brand eins’ editors only a couple of days ago. Addressing 300 members of the VDR (German Travel Management Federation), Dr. Norbert Walter stated that times would get tougher but that there was no occasion for immediate panic. ‘The more we held video conferences the greater was the need for physical presence on the part of our clients’. And the same applies as much to meetings and conferences as to congresses and events.
So please don’t panic.
